The Role

We are looking for an experienced Scrum Master to join Capco’s consulting team and support one of our clients within the financial services industry.

You will join a multidisciplinary team, where the focus is on creating, maintaining and continuously improving automation solutions, including robots and chatbots.

The team works with technologies such as Blue Prism to automate processes and improve the way client services are delivered.

As Scrum Master, your role is to enable the team to perform at its best. You will facilitate the Agile way of working, help remove impediments, strengthen collaboration and support continuous improvement across the team.

You will work closely with the Product Owner, technology specialists, business stakeholders and other teams to ensure smooth and effective delivery.

 What You Will Do
  • Facilitate Agile ceremonies including Sprint Planning, Daily Scrums, Sprint Reviews, Retrospectives and backlog refinement sessions.

  • Coach and support the team in applying Scrum and Agile principles in a pragmatic and effective way.

  • Identify and help remove impediments that impact the team’s progress.

  • Foster ownership, collaboration and continuous improvement within the team.

  • Work closely with the Product Owner to ensure effective backlog management and sprint preparation.

  • Facilitate communication and alignment between business and technology stakeholders.

  • Create transparency around progress, priorities, dependencies and risks.

  • Support the delivery and continuous improvement of automation solutions, including robots and chatbots.

  • Help the team improve its Ways of Working and increase its delivery maturity.

  • Contribute to successful delivery within a complex financial services environment.

 What We Are Looking ForExperience
  • Around 5 years of relevant professional experience, with solid experience as a Scrum Master.

  • Proven experience working in Agile and Scrum delivery environments.

  • Previous experience within banking or financial services is considered as a plus.

  • Experience working in a consulting or client-facing environment is considered an advantage.

  • Experience with Blue Prism, or with teams working with Blue Prism, is considered a strong advantage.

Languages
  • Professional proficiency in English.

  • Professional proficiency in Dutch and/or French.


Working Model

This is a consulting role based in Belgium. You will work in a hybrid environment, combining client-site, Capco office and remote working depending on project requirements.
